How does my home know to use the solar power before grid power?

Or, is there typically a sub panel set up for specific appliances only? I can''t find a pic or diagram of how the physical connections are made. 2) How does my home know to draw from the solar power first before grid power? If all the power is coming in to the breaker box, what makes solar power be the first choice?

6 Frequently Asked Questions about “How to set up smart timing for home solar power supply”

Why do I need a solar timer?

The thinking behind the timer is to set the load such as a hot water system or pool pump to come on during the day when the sun is shining. This helps to ensure that the majority of the power for these loads is coming from your solar power system rather than from the power grid.

Should I use a timer with my solar PV system?

Using a timer with your solar PV system will help you manage connected devices and maximize the energy usage from your batteries and panels. Installing a timer with your solar system is the next step in maximizing your energy usage, whether during the day or night.

Do you need a solar panel timer?

Many homes use AC timers to control heavy-draw appliances like electrical water heaters and pool pumps. Where you have a PV system delivering power from an inverter, using a solar panel timer to manage consumption is convenient and efficient.

What is a 12V DC solar panel timer?

The 12V DC solar panel timer is designed to manage the operating times of any devices connected to the system. This ensures that the power generated doesn't get drained as any devices that aren't needed aren't running. Before we get into this, you need to know that a solar timer does not control power generation from the solar panels.
